During the 2020-2021 academic year, Wellesley College handed out 42 bachelor's degrees in political science & government. This is a decrease of 13% over the previous year when 48 degrees were handed out.

How Much Do Political Science Graduates from Wellesley Make?

$37,693 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Political Science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

The median salary of political science students who receive their bachelor's degree at Wellesley is $37,693. This is great news for graduates of the program, since this figure is higher than the national average of $33,089 for all political science bachelor's degree recipients.

How Much Student Debt Do Political Science Graduates from Wellesley Have?

$12,500 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Political Science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at Wellesley, political science students borrow a median amount of $12,500 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all political science b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$24,439.
